/**
 * Holds a reference to a document. A document reference is a reference to a specific record in a collection. You can
 * use it to read or write data to the document. A document can refer to a row in a table in a relational database or a
 * document in a NoSQL database. Additionally, a document reference can refer to a non-existent document, which you can
 * use to create a new document.
 *
 * Read more about document references in the
 * {@link https://docs.getsquid.ai/docs/sdk/client-sdk/database/document-reference documentation}.
 * @typeParam T The type of the document data.
 * @category Database
 */
export declare class DocumentReference<T extends DocumentData = any> {
    private _squidDocId;
    private readonly dataManager;
    private readonly queryBuilderFactory;
    /** A string that uniquely identifies this document reference. */
    refId: string;
    /**
     * Returns the document data. Throws an error if the document does not exist.
     *
     * @returns The document data.
     * @throws Error if the document does not exist.
     */
    get data(): T;
    /**
     * Returns a read-only internal copy of the document data. This works similar to `this.data`, except it does not
     * perform a defensive copy. The caller may not modify this object, on penalty of unexpected behavior.
     *
     * @returns The document data.
     * @throws Error if the document does not exist.
     */
    get dataRef(): T;
    /**
     * Returns whether data has been populated for this document reference. Data
     * will not present if a document has not been queried, does not exist, or
     * has been deleted.
     *
     * @returns Whether the document has data.
     */
    get hasData(): boolean;
    /**
     * A promise that resolves with the latest data from the server or undefined if the document does not exist on the
     * server.
     *
     * @returns A promise that resolves with latest data from the server or undefined if the document does not exist on
     * the server.
     */
    snapshot(): Promise<T | undefined>;
    /**
     * Returns an observable that emits the latest data from the server or undefined if the document is deleted or does
     * not exist on the server.
     *
     * @returns An observable that emits the latest data from the server or undefined if the document is deleted or does
     * not exist on the server.
     */
    snapshots(): Observable<T | undefined>;
    /**
     * Returns the data that is currently available on the client or undefined if data has not yet been populated.
     *
     * @returns The data that is currently available on the client or undefined if data has not yet been populated.
     */
    peek(): T | undefined;
    /**
     * Returns whether the locally available version of the document may not be the latest version on the server.
     *
     * @returns Whether the locally available version of the document may not be the latest version on the server.
     */
    isDirty(): boolean;
    private isTracked;
    /**
     * Updates the document with the given data.
     * The `update` will be reflected optimistically locally and will be applied to the server later.
     * If a transactionId is provided, the `update` will be applied to the server as an atomic operation together with
     * the rest of the operations in the transaction and the `update` will not reflect locally until the transaction is
     * completed locally.
     *
     * The returned promise will resolve once the `update` has been applied to the server or immediately if the `update`
     * is part of a transaction.
     *
     * @param data The data to update - can be partial.
     * @param transactionId The transaction to use for this operation. If not provided, the operation will be applied
     *   immediately.
     */
    update(data: Partial<DeepRecord<T>>, transactionId?: TransactionId): Promise<void>;
    /**
     * Similar to {@link update}, but only updates the given path.
     * @param path The path to update.
     * @param value The value to set at the given path.
     * @param transactionId The transaction to use for this operation. If not provided, the operation will be applied
     *   immediately.
     */
    setInPath<K extends Paths<T>>(path: K, value: DeepRecord<T>[K], transactionId?: TransactionId): Promise<void>;
    /**
     * Similar to `update`, but only deletes the given path.
     * @param path The path to delete.
     * @param transactionId The transaction to use for this operation. If not provided, the operation will be applied
     *   immediately.
     */
    deleteInPath(path: Paths<T>, transactionId?: TransactionId): Promise<void>;
    /**
     * Increments the value at the given path by the given value. The value may be both positive and negative.
     * @param path The path to the value to increment.
     * @param value The value to increment by.
     * @param transactionId The transaction to use for this operation. If not provided, the operation will be applied
     *   immediately.
     */
    incrementInPath(path: Paths<T>, value: number, transactionId?: TransactionId): Promise<void>;
    /**
     * Decrements the value at the given path by the given value. The value may be both positive and negative.
     * @param path The path to the value to decrement.
     * @param value The value to decrement by.
     * @param transactionId The transaction to use for this operation. If not provided, the operation will be applied
     *   immediately.
     */
    decrementInPath(path: Paths<T>, value: number, transactionId?: TransactionId): Promise<void>;
    /**
     * Inserts the document with the given data. If the document already exists, the operation will be treated as
     * `upsert`. The `insert` will be reflected optimistically locally and will be applied to the server later. If a
     * transactionId is provided, the `insert` will be applied to the server as an atomic operation together with the
     * rest
     * of the operations in the transaction and the `insert` will not reflect locally until the transaction is completed
     * locally.
     *
     * The returned promise will resolve once the `insert` has been applied to the server or immediately if the `insert`
     * is part of a transaction.
     *
     * @param data The data to insert.
     * @param transactionId The transaction to use for this operation. If not provided, the operation will be applied
     *   immediately.
     */
    insert(data: Omit<T, '__id'>, transactionId?: TransactionId): Promise<void>;
    /**
     * Deletes the document.
     * The `delete` will be reflected optimistically locally and will be applied to the server later.
     * If a transactionId is provided, the `delete` will be applied to the server as an atomic operation together with
     * the rest of the operations in the transaction and the `delete` will not reflect locally until the transaction is
     * completed locally.
     *
     * The returned promise will resolve once the `delete` has been applied to the server or immediately if the `delete`
     * is part of a transaction.
     *
     * @param transactionId The transaction to use for this operation. If not provided, the operation will be applied
     *   immediately.
     */
    delete(transactionId?: TransactionId): Promise<void>;
    private hasSquidPlaceholderId;
}
